Special pensions derived from acts of terrorism

People who become disabled or whose family members die as a result of acts of terrorism shall be entitled, respectively, to special disability, death or survival pensions.

In order to qualify for these pensions in the Social Security System, these victims of acts of terrorism need:

  • to be affiliated to the Social Security.
  • to have active contributor status (or not) in any of the Social Security schemes.

The calculation method that applies to these pensions is the same as that for disability and survival pensions arising from work-related injuries.
